Mark Fergus

Writer, Producer

An OSCAR-nominee, Mark Fergus has crafted memorable scripts for hits like CHILDREN OF MEN, IRON MAN, and the TV series THE EXPANSE. His broad range of expertise across various genres has solidified his reputation as a skilled and adaptable writer. Mark Fergus will hold a 1on1 masterclass with 2026's 1st place winner (FEATURE category).

 

Jessica Sharzer

Writer, Producer

A three-time EMMY-nominee, Jessica Sharzer is a writer, producer, and director best known for her work on NERVE, AMERICAN HORROR STORY, the mystery thriller A SIMPLE FAVOR and NINE PERFECT STRANGERS. Jessica Sharzer will hold a 1on1 masterclass with 2026's 1st place winner (TV PILOT category).

Kenneth Kokin

Producer, Director, Executive

Kokin, a seasoned executive, consultant, producer, writer, and director, has enjoyed a thriving career spanning over 30 years in the entertainment industry. His diverse expertise encompasses feature films, TV, and animation, resulting in notable accomplishments, including winning over 80 awards. Notably, he directed the extensive second unit for the double Oscar-winning film THE USUAL SUSPECTS, which he also produced. Two films he produced garnered The Grand Jury Prize and Best International Drama at the Sundance Film Festival.

 

Kristina Rivera

Producer, Executive

Kristina Rivera is best known for her collaborations with Clint Eastwood. She began her career at Malpaso Productions as his assistant on INVICTUS and worked on J. EDGAR and JERSEY BOYS before her promotion to associate producer on AMERICAN SNIPER. Rivera subsequently brought the screenplay SULLY to Eastwood and was co-producer on the film. She then developed the THE 15:17 TO PARIS screenplay with first time writer Dorothy Blyskal, and garnered the title Producer. She also produced THE MULE and was a co-executive producer on Aaron Sorkin's film THE TRIAL OF THE CHICAGO 7.

 

Molly Conners

Producer, Executive, Director

Molly is an Emmy-nominated producer and member of the Producers Guild of America, BAFTA, and the Television Academy. Over the past 15 years, she has produced or executive produced 35 films that have earned 4 Academy Awards and 11 nominations. Notable credits include BIRDMAN, FROZEN RIVER, KILLER JOE, THE IMMIGRANT and RULES DON'T APPLY.

Contest Rules

1) Submitted scripts must be original screenplays, and the sole property of the applicant(s). Screenplays submitted must not have been previously sold or produced. Adapted or based on screenplays are also accepted. It is the sole responsibility of the applicant to register their screenplay and secure clearance from the copyright holders of any copyrighted materials included within the submitted screenplay. Also, novels, stage plays, short stories, treatments, synopses or scripts based on existing material created without permission will not be accepted in the contest. All entrants, including the nominees and winners, retain complete and exclusive rights to their work.

2) All ages are eligible, and you can submit from any country.

3) All entries must be in English.

4) We accept screenplays between 1–140 pages in length. For scripts over 140 pages (features), 70 pages (pilots) or 45 pages (shorts), an additional fee of $1 per extra page will apply.

5) There is no limit to the number of screenplays you may submit.

6) All entries must be uploaded in PDF/FDX format. Contact details or names are allowed to be on the title page, but not recommended.

7) All screenplays should be written in industry standard format (Courier 12 pt font).

8) Substitutions of either corrected pages or new drafts of the entry screenplay(s) are accepted for an additional fee and should be submitted via https://goldenscript.net/extra.

9) Competition judges, readers and employees of our competition, past and present, and their immediate friends and families, are NOT eligible to enter. Previous winning and finalist scripts are also NOT eligible.

10) Entries must be received on or before the deadlines and submission fee payment must be made in full at time of the submission. Entry fees (including services fees) are non-refundable and we do not provide any feedback (except for paid feedback)
